
AI Agent for Kibana MCP
Integrate your Kibana analytics with MCP-compatible clients for seamless natural language and programmatic access. The Kibana MCP Server enables secure connection, real-time API endpoint management, and multi-space support, making your Elastic Stack analytics accessible through tools like Claude Desktop. Benefit from type-safe integration, robust authentication, and dynamic access to Kibana resources for enhanced data-driven decision making.

Effortless Kibana API Access
Connect to local or remote Kibana instances securely and access all API endpoints from MCP-compatible clients. The integration provides type-safe, extensible, and easy-to-use tools for searching, viewing, and executing Kibana APIs. Enhance your analytics workflow by managing queries, dashboards, and cases directly through natural language or programmatic requests.
- Secure Connection.
- Authenticate using username/password and connect with SSL/TLS support for both local and remote Kibana servers.
- Full API Endpoint Coverage.
- Access, search, and execute any Kibana API endpoint directly from your MCP client.
- Multi-Space Support.
- Switch between multiple Kibana spaces, ideal for complex enterprise environments.
- Natural Language & Programmatic Access.
- Perform queries and actions using natural language or code, thanks to Claude Desktop and MCP compatibility.

Real-Time Elastic Analytics
Get instant status updates, list all API endpoints, and retrieve details for dashboards, cases, and saved objects. Stay informed with real-time data and enable rapid troubleshooting for your Elastic Stack environment.
- Status Monitoring.
- Instantly check the health and status of your Kibana server, including by space.
- Endpoint Discovery.
- List and search all available Kibana API endpoints with powerful filtering.
- Resource Insight.
- Retrieve details for specific API endpoints, dashboards, and saved objects for deeper insights.

Flexible, Type-Safe Automation
Leverage the full power of Kibana's API with type-safe integration and automation. Execute custom API requests, manage spaces, and configure advanced settings with confidence—whether you use CLI, config files, or environment variables.
- Flexible Automation.
- Automate actions and integrations with CLI, config files, or environment variables.
- Type-Safe Operations.
- Enjoy robust, error-resistant integrations with clear type definitions and schema validation.
- Advanced Resource Prompts.
- Switch between tool-based and resource-based prompt modes for optimal flexibility in Claude Desktop and other MCP clients.
MCP INTEGRATION
Available Kibana MCP Integration Tools
The following tools are available as part of the Kibana MCP integration:
- get_status
Get the current status of the Kibana server, optionally targeting a specific Kibana space.
- execute_api
Execute a custom Kibana API request by specifying the HTTP method, path, and optional parameters or body.
- get_available_spaces
Retrieve a list of available Kibana spaces and view the current context, with optional detailed info.
- search_kibana_api_paths
Search Kibana API endpoints by keyword to quickly find relevant API paths.
- list_all_kibana_api_paths
List all available Kibana API endpoints accessible via the server.
- get_kibana_api_detail
Get details for a specific Kibana API endpoint by method and path.
Connect Your Kibana with FlowHunt AI
Connect your Kibana to a FlowHunt AI Agent. Book a personalized demo or try FlowHunt free today!
What is Kibana MCP Server
Kibana MCP Server is a community-maintained implementation that enables MCP-compatible clients to access, search, and manage Kibana instances using natural language or programmatic requests. Designed for seamless integration, it supports both local and remote Kibana deployments, secure authentication, and SSL/TLS. By exposing Kibana API endpoints, it allows users to interact with Kibana resources in a type-safe and extensible manner, making it ideal for developers and analysts who want an efficient, user-friendly way to control and automate Kibana operations without relying on the official Elastic stack.
Capabilities
What we can do with Kibana MCP Server
Kibana MCP Server allows users to connect to and manage Kibana instances through a wide range of capabilities, including secure access, automation, and programmatic control. Its features are designed to streamline Kibana operations for both technical and non-technical users.
- Natural language queries
- Interact with Kibana APIs using plain English for easier data access and management.
- Custom API requests
- Execute complex, programmatic operations against your Kibana instance from any MCP-compatible client.
- Secure integration
- Connect to local or remote Kibana securely with support for authentication and SSL/TLS.
- Automated resource management
- Automate the creation, updating, and deletion of Kibana resources through scripts or agents.
- Type-safe extensibility
- Benefit from a robust, type-safe integration layer for building custom workflows or tools.

What is Kibana MCP Server
AI agents can leverage Kibana MCP Server to automate data analysis, dashboard management, and search operations within Kibana environments. By providing a natural language interface and programmatic API access, the service empowers AI agents to efficiently retrieve information, trigger workflows, and maintain Kibana resources without manual intervention.